I know that until recently the Cordova plugin repository had an > old version. > > —Jens > > I was doing a mistake which was falsely making me believe that CBLite was updated but it wasn't actually. What i was doing it that i was issuing cordova add plugin command for cblite without removing the previous version. This isn't the correct way because though in the plugin files you will find the new version number, it doesn't update the source files. I got to know about this when i completely removed the older plugin and installed the newer one (i.e 1.0.3).
This gave good as well as bad news. Good news is that now when i build and run the app in ios simulator and check the logs the *_changes feed parse error is no longer occuring !!* Bad news is that after updating my cordova project with cblite 1.0.3 it isn't letting me archive my app and generate a IPA file.
